Holls 1505 Posted July 9, 2017 35 minutes ago, Matt32790 said: Hey holls thank you so much for the reply! What do you do to calm down, I am struggling to find a way to switch off, I have to go back to work tomorrow, the though of it has me a bit of a mess I ride my bike or walk.. endorphins help get rid of all the adrenaline anxiety creates. I meditate for ten min in the morning.. and when my thoughts start turning to my fears I have to remind myself .. these are only thoughts.. they aren't real and I try to bring my thoughts to the present..I have to redirect my thoughts like this A LOT!!!! But it helps. My thoughts can run so wild that before I know it I'm terrified I have a horrible illness. A great man on the forum put it so simply... Health anxiety is a thinking disorder. And boy is it.. Work sometimes made me anxious but it will probably help to keep your mind busy. I quit and stay home with the little ones.. I have way too much thinking time lol. I started painting projects and it has helped. Let me know how work goes for you tomorrow, I bet you have a great Monday. You got this, you are stronger than your thoughts.
